Output 56d89652c89bd5baf664cca01e2b82cba498f26bb2f90a7be768f3bb9bf1e2f9:33

value
29933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36c5290e33942e964282ae0d4f4c501a565b819b OP_EQUAL
address
36gcbqzQWAa6ApgCfu7SGqN4H7SpLttjmH
transaction
56d89652c89bd5baf664cca01e2b82cba498f26bb2f90a7be768f3bb9bf1e2f9
confirmations
254303
spent
true